Monkey3 + Touch Pro = ScummVM crashes by pushing a Button!

Subforum for discussion and help with ScummVM's PocketPC/HandheldPC port

Moderator: ScummVM Team

Post Reply
MauRi
Posts: 4
Joined: Thu May 13, 2010 6:05 pm

Monkey3 + Touch Pro = ScummVM crashes by pushing a Button!

Post by MauRi »

Hey Guys!
I hope you can help me. Today I spend my time to install ScummVM (Version 1.1.1) and Monkey 3 on the devise HTC Touch Pro (using WM 6.5 Build 21872) !
So far, so good.
After I figured out, how to use ScummVM, how to assign the keys and how to make to disappear the menu-bar at the bottom I was really happy to meet Guybrush Threepwood again!
The encounter with Wally ends, as expected, in crying and I wanted to save the game.

Pushing the key to make the menu-bar appear, ScummVM crashes totally! I tried some other keys, but always the same reaction.

Any ideas to solve this problem?
Greetz
MauRi
User avatar
robinwatts
ScummVM Developer
Posts: 84
Joined: Sat Apr 07, 2007 5:16 pm
Location: Hook Norton, Oxfordshire, UK

Post by robinwatts »

OK, so that's a 640x480 device. I'll see if I can provoke the same problem on my 800x480 device here at some point - but I can't promise when...

Robin
MauRi
Posts: 4
Joined: Thu May 13, 2010 6:05 pm

Post by MauRi »

Big thx!

Next question: there are 3 different versions of ScummVM

ScummVM: quits with an error: (2:2003:0xB6): createResource(Sound,246): Out of memory while allocating 1966160
Any ideas why? Free program-memory-space~ 85MB
The gamefiles are stored on the memorystick. There I have ~500MB free. Dont know if its important to know.

ScummVM1: COMI crashes by pushing any button. Taking the staff from the wall first and then speaking to Wally or first speaking to Wally has no effect/make no difference. Its something like a time-bomb. After about 15sec. any button ends in crashing the program

ScummVM2: pushing the start-button has no effect. Only the menu-bar of ScummVM appears in the bottom. When clicking on the ape to rotate the screen, an information says, that
using SDL driver wingapi
Display 480x640 (real 480x640)



Monkey 2 runs without problems.
User avatar
robinwatts
ScummVM Developer
Posts: 84
Joined: Sat Apr 07, 2007 5:16 pm
Location: Hook Norton, Oxfordshire, UK

Post by robinwatts »

I can confirm that I have reproduced the problem on my device. Can't promise how long it will take to find time to look for a cure though.
MauRi wrote:Next question: there are 3 different versions of ScummVM
Yes. And the ReadMe-WinCE.txt explains why.

Scumm is a combined build with all the engines in. Expect this to be too big for some devices to cope with. Hence we provide 2 smaller 'split' executables.
ScummVM: quits with an error: (2:2003:0xB6): createResource(Sound,246): Out of memory while allocating 1966160
Any ideas why? Free program-memory-space~ 85MB
The gamefiles are stored on the memorystick. There I have ~500MB free. Dont know if its important to know.
It's too big. 85Meg of build in memory does not mean 85 Meg of memory available to a single process.
ScummVM1: COMI crashes by pushing any button. Taking the staff from the wall first and then speaking to Wally or first speaking to Wally has no effect/make no difference. Its something like a time-bomb. After about 15sec. any button ends in crashing the program
This is the problem we're investigating, yes.
ScummVM2: pushing the start-button has no effect. Only the menu-bar of ScummVM appears in the bottom. When clicking on the ape to rotate the screen, an information says, that
using SDL driver wingapi
Display 480x640 (real 480x640)
There is no Scumm engine built into ScummVM2 - I'm surprised you even get that far. You wouldn't expect it to cope.

Robin
MauRi
Posts: 4
Joined: Thu May 13, 2010 6:05 pm

Post by MauRi »

Thank you very much for your support.
First of all: for sure, I had to read the text-file. Sry

The bottom line is I have to use ScummVM without any numbers, right? But it isnt working. Is there a possibilty to fix this problem or avoiding it?
Iam not sure, but I think I read somewhere, that another version dont load all Files, only the ones that are in this moment needed?! Would this virtual machine avoiding the problem with out of memory-Error?

So long,
MauRi
User avatar
robinwatts
ScummVM Developer
Posts: 84
Joined: Sat Apr 07, 2007 5:16 pm
Location: Hook Norton, Oxfordshire, UK

Post by robinwatts »

MauRi wrote:The bottom line is I have to use ScummVM without any numbers, right?
No.

ScummVM without any numbers is the one with all the engines built in. If you use that it's quite likely that you'll run out of memory and die.

Instead you should use *either* ScummVM1.exe or ScummVM2.exe as appropriate for the game you are trying to play.

For COMI this means you should use ScummVM1.exe. That seems to make the game work, until you run into the 'crashing when pressing a button' problem. That's a bug I need to look into.

Robin
amin123
Posts: 1
Joined: Tue Jun 01, 2010 2:48 pm

Post by amin123 »

robinwatts wrote: For COMI this means you should use ScummVM1.exe. That seems to make the game work, until you run into the 'crashing when pressing a button' problem. That's a bug I need to look into.

Robin
I have the same problem with Monkey Island 3 (HTC HD2/Version 1.1.1), is there any solution yet?

greets
User avatar
robinwatts
ScummVM Developer
Posts: 84
Joined: Sat Apr 07, 2007 5:16 pm
Location: Hook Norton, Oxfordshire, UK

Post by robinwatts »

amin123 wrote:I have the same problem with Monkey Island 3 (HTC HD2/Version 1.1.1), is there any solution yet?
I haven't had a chance to look yet, and it will be at least a few weeks before I do. If anyone else cares to try to find the bug, please feel free!

Sorry,

Robin
MauRi
Posts: 4
Joined: Thu May 13, 2010 6:05 pm

Post by MauRi »

Don't rush! Iam now playing MI2, its cool too!

I was just impressed as i saw MI3 on the HTC TOuch Pro. I didn't knew that my phone is able to handle the game.

I would search for the bug, but i have no idea of the software and first of all: how to search for it.

Thx for the support anyway!
MauRi
aplnx
Posts: 2
Joined: Wed Sep 01, 2010 12:00 am

I'm having the same problem

Post by aplnx »

I was playing Full Throttle when the game crashed. The message occured in createResource(sound, 749) function. I can't see the complete message but I guess that is Out of memory.

I have HTC Touch (p3450 elf) with windows mobile. How I can disable the sound to continue playing?
Post Reply